1

Smash Your Deadlines: The Deadline Slayer App

News Discuss 
Are you constantly struggling to achieve your deadlines? Do stressful work weeks exhaust you out? Then say hello – the Deadline Slayer App is here to save you from the clutches of procrastination and pending https://deborahgqhd970847.livebloggs.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story